Abstract

In Malaysia, Malaysian Sign Language (MSL) serves as a vital means of communication for the deaf community, yet its usage in daily interactions remains limited, particularly among hearing individuals. The absence of understanding MSL poses significant inconvenience and barriers for effective communication between deaf and hearing individuals. Previous research predominantly focused on image classification, constraining the potential of MSL translation systems. This project aims to develop an advanced MSL translator capable of detecting various sign gestures from both images and videos and translating them into coherent sentences and speech. Leveraging the power of OpenCV, TensorFlow, and Mediapipe software, the proposed model offer real-time translation capabilities, facilitating seamless communication between the deaf and hearing communities. By enabling the deaf to communicate effectively with hearing individuals, whether in face-to-face interactions or online meetings, the developed MSL translator endeavors to bridge the longstanding communication gap. Its successful implementation holds the promise of fostering inclusivity, understanding, and collaboration between these two communities, there by enhancing social integration and accessibility for the deaf population in Malaysia. In conclusion, the realization of this translator signifies a crucial step towards breaking down communication barriers, fostering empathy, and promoting inclusivity in Malaysian society.
